Performance and Handling

Under its hood, the 2006 Audi A4 quattro houses a potent 3.2-liter V6 engine, fueled by premium gasoline. Mated to a smooth 6-speed automatic transmission (S6), it delivers a spirited performance. With 255 horsepower, the A4 quattro acc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in just 6.4 seconds, combining brisk acceleration with refined handling.

  • Fuel consumption of approximately 14.875 l/100 km, perfect for enthusiasts willing to trade efficiency for performance.
  • Precise Quattro all-wheel-drive system providing excellent grip in varied conditions.
  • Agile handling making city driving a breeze and highway cruising enjoyable.
  • Dynamic suspension ensuring a balanced, comfortable ride.

The Audi A4’s performance credentials make it a joy to drive in diverse environments, embodying superior German engineering.

Maintenance and Common Issues

Owning a luxury vehicle like the Audi A4 comes with maintenance considerations. Annual maintenance costs can be higher, averaging around $1,200 USD. Common issues include:

  • Oil leaks from the valve cover gaskets.
  • Failure of ignition coils potentially leading to misfires.
  • Suspension component wear, requiring periodic checks.
  • Water pump failures, especially in older models.
  • Electrical system glitches affecting power windows and locks.

Being proactive with service can mitigate these concerns.
